description The coulometric method presented here is a reliable method for the direct analysis of CO(2)/air cylinder gas mixtures. It is based on Faraday’s laws of electrolysis and therefore no external standardization is required. A series of CO(2)/air cylinder gas mixtures ranging in concentration from 300 to 375 µmol/mol (ppm) were analyzed and the results compared to those results obtained by non-dispersive infrared (NDIR) analysis with traceability to gravimetric standards. The coulometric method is rapid, sensitive, precise, and with the proper experimental controls, will yield accurate results.
